# This Makefile ensures that the build is made out of source in a
# subdirectory called 'build' If it doesn't exist, it is created.
#
# This Makefile also contains delegation of the most common make commands
#
# If you have cmake installed you should be able to do:
#
#	make
#	make test
#	make install
#	make package
#
# That should build Cgreen in the build directory, run some tests,
# install it locally and generate a distributable package.

# Find out if 'uname -o' works, if it does - use it, otherwise use 'uname -s'
UNAMEOEXISTS=$(shell uname -o &>/dev/null; echo $$?)
ifeq ($(UNAMEOEXISTS),0)
  OS=$(shell uname -o)
else
  OS=$(shell uname -s)
endif

# Set prefix and suffix for shared libraries depending on platform
ifeq ($(OS),Darwin)
	LDPATH=DYLD_LIBRARY_PATH=$(PWD)/build/src
	PREFIX=lib
	SUFFIX=.dylib
else ifeq ($(OS),Cygwin)
	LDPATH=PATH=$(PWD)/build/src:"$$PATH"
	PREFIX=cyg
	SUFFIX=.dll
else ifeq ($(OS),Msys)
# This is for Msys "proper"
# TODO: handle Msys/Mingw32/64
	LDPATH=PATH=$(PWD)/build/src:"$$PATH"
	PREFIX=msys-
	SUFFIX=.dll
else
	LDPATH=LD_LIBRARY_PATH=$(PWD)/build/src
	PREFIX=lib
	SUFFIX=.so
endif
